As a senior member of the commercial team, you will lead on procurement, oversee multiple complex subcontract packages and provide strategic commercial guidance to ensure project success. This is a key leadership role, requiring strong technical, financial and people management skills.
Requirements
Work with the senior project team to procure key subcontract packages and other critical elements of the works.
Generating quantified work packages, ITTs & budgets from technical documents. Analysis & presentation of tender returns.
Preparation and agreement of subcontract documents.
Commercial management of multiple subcontract packages from order through to final account, monthly payments, variation and claims management.
Continuous monitoring of costs and financial entitlement on the packages / projects under your control.
Active engagement with stakeholders including clients, subcontractors, designers and internal team members.
Submission of contractually compliant commercial documentation.
Development, submission and agreement of external valuations.
Negotiation and agreement of variations, omissions and final accounts with subcontractors and clients in a timely and professional manner.
Regular cost / value and cash flow reporting.
Pro-actively work to resolve conflicts where possible.
Supervision and development of junior members of the commercial team.
Skills /
Qualifications:
Relevant degree with 5+ years’ experience in a main contracting and / or specialist contracting environment with a particular focus on mechanical and electrical works.
Strong technical understanding of MEP installations & processes.
Familiarity with various methods of measurement.
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to build strong business relationships.
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
Excellent budgeting and financial forecasting skills.
Familiarity with Buildsoft, CostX or similar is advantageous.
